Volunteer roles available in:

  • Squirrels (4–6 yrs) – storytelling, play, and first friendships.

  • Beavers (6–8 yrs) – crafts, games, and learning new things.

  • Cubs (8–10½ yrs) – exploring, teamwork, and outdoor skills.

  • Scouts (10½–14 yrs) – adventure, responsibility, and independence.

  • Explorers (14–18 yrs) – leadership, community service, and big challenges.
